How is this score calculated?
Financial strength13/25 pts

Net worth compared to all companies in the same SIC code with published accounts. Top quartile earns the full 25 points.

Employees15/15 pts

Workforce size relative to sector peers from the most recent accounts. A larger team generally signals commercial scale.

Liquidity0/20 pts

Current assets ÷ current liabilities. A ratio above 2× earns full marks; between 1–2× scores partially; below 0.5× scores minimal points.

Longevity6/15 pts

One point per year of operation since incorporation, capped at 15. Older companies have a proven track record.

Filing compliance15/15 pts

Full 15 points when both annual accounts and confirmation statement are filed on time. Points are deducted for each overdue filing.

Risk deductions

Going concern doubt: -10 pts

Maximum score is 100. Deductions apply for insolvency history, outstanding charges, going concern doubt, or disqualified officers.
